Introduction

1

1.0

I

NTRODUCTION

The OpenComms NIC Card transforms Liebert units into manageable

nodes within your Network, NMS, and BMS systems.
The OpenComms NIC Card contains a standard Ethernet and EIA-485

(2-wire) port designed to support viewing and management through:

HTTP for Web browsers (I.E. 5.5 or later)
SNMP (v1, v2c) for network management systems
Modbus RTU for building management systems (and SiteScan)

For the first time, the system that monitors the status of your comput-

ing, communication and facility infrastructure can comprehensively

monitor your Liebert equipment concurrently.
These standard open protocols allow simple integration into your mon-

itoring system, leveraging prior infrastructure investments and estab-

lished procedures.
